Your Impact on the team

The Program Manager is responsible for planning, scheduling, and tracking of programs within our Higher Education Business Unit. This role will partner with technical product management, architecture, engineering, and the business to provide leadership in delivering innovative digital solutions to our customers. This position will not only focus on the planning, communication and coordination of large-scale software development programs but also beyond the end date to the transitional and operational elements. This role is accountable to sponsors for schedule and quality of all program elements. This role may also be accountable for platform level program leadership, including resolving risks, providing leadership to agile teams, and providing clear status and communications. This role requires a strong user focus. 

This is a remote position open to applicants authorized to work for any employer within the United States. It requires up to 20% travel for the year

What You will be doing:

  • Facilitates delivery of larger cross-team programs by ensuring the team drives commitments to completion on time and quality. Includes facilitating project initiation, tracking milestones, solving risks, and managing dependencies from development through testing and release.
  • Ability to work out complex dependencies and escalate issues across impacted projects, programs, and teams up and down the chain as necessary.
  • Can drive scaled agile planning and execution methodologies for teams or projects that require it.
  • Partner closely with product and engineering leadership to provide guidance and leadership across multiple platform teams. May run ceremonies meetings that span multiple teams to bring alignment across the platform, such as platform-wide demos.
  • Champion agile methodologies throughout the development process and adherence to the SDLC. Coach on agile practices within assigned programs. 
  • May act as scrum master to 1-2 teams. Ensure appropriate ceremonies occur with valuable outcomes. Drives continuous team improvement.
  • Ensures projects follow the SDLC including a prioritized backlog, documented delivery plan, iteration and dependency identification. 
  • Own and manage communication plan across programs. Can communicate clearly and articulately to both senior leadership and agile teams.
  • Ensure transparency and buy in on key decisions. Proactively removes impediments to ensure successful delivery of team commitments. Drives issue resolution and risk mitigation.
  • Ensures customer support is appropriately prioritized, and SLAs are honored. 
  • Assists with Product Operations requests (Rostering, Team and Program Metrics reporting, etc.)
